Japan
19 August - 3 September 2006


Japan will be the host for the most important basketball event on the globe: the 2006 Basketball World Championships. It’s the first time that the country of the rising sun is hosting a championship of this magnitude.
The number of teams has been increased from 16 to 24. With this decision, FIBA reacted to the improved level of play on a global level and the fact that basketball is the most widespread indoor team sport around the world.
Most countries will qualify through the 5 continental championships in summer 2005, but 4 countries will receive a wild card based on certain criteria.

For one team, there will be a special task: after the disappointing sixth place in Indianapolis, the USA will try everything the regain the position as the dominating basketball power over the past 5 decades. But it needs their best to fulfil that mission….

Teams qualified for the 2006 Basketball World Championship:
 
Angola
Argentina
Australia
Brazil
Germany
France
Greece
Japan
Lebanon
Lithuania
New Zealand
Nigeria
Panama
China
Qatar
Senegal
Slovenia
Spain
USA
Venezuela
